Preparing for a Legal Consultation

Before speaking with a lawyer, it can be helpful to organize important information related to the matter. Documents, correspondence, contracts, records, photographs, or other relevant materials may help an attorney understand the situation more clearly.

Clients should also prepare a list of questions they want to ask. This can make the consultation more productive and ensure that important concerns are discussed.
